WebMold growth can be removed from hard surfaces with commercial products, soap and water, or a bleach solution of no more than 1 cup (8 ounces) of bleach in 1 gallon of water to kill mold on surfaces. Never mix bleach with ammonia or other household cleaners. If you choose to use bleach to clean up mold: WebAug 24, 2024 · Prepare a soapy solution with water and detergent. Spray the moldy surface and use a soft-bristled brush to scrub the mold away. You can also dip the brush into soapy water. Dry the wood surface with a towel to minimize the chances of a recurrence. WebSep 16, 2024 · Black mold naturally grows on materials containing cellulose. These are plant based materials such as paper, cardboard, and wood. Keep a close eye on any paneling or file cabinets that get wet. Any wood, drywall, carpet, or cloth can easily grow black mold under moist conditions. WebMay 19, 2024 · Black mold on walls grows fast Keep in mind that mold can start to develop between 24 and 48 hours of a material getting wet. It will continue growing until it is eliminated (the moisture problem remedied and the mold-contaminated materials removed).
